Muslims Gather For Mecca Pilgrimage
Saudi Arabia is a busy spot right now as Muslims from around the world gather to partake in a religious pilgrimage. The pilgrimage to Mecca is one of the five pillars of Islam, and is an obligation for all Muslims at least once during their lives if they can afford to do so.
It is reported that 1.5 million Muslims have already arrived and those numbers are expected to rise to 2 million. Participants begin their 'haj' on Thursday assembling in the valley of Mina and dawn Friday move towards Mount Arafat where they spend the day praying and ask for God's forgiveness. On Saturday they celebrate Eid al-Adha (Feast of the Sacrifice), usually a sheep back at the Mina valley and stay there for two days before attending another rite where standing stone pillars are stoned in a ceremony that symbolizes their willingness to renounce evil.
